首頁 > 資料庫 > mysql教程 > 在 macOS 上安裝 MySQLdb for Django 時如何修復「找不到 mysql_config」錯誤?

在 macOS 上安裝 MySQLdb for Django 時如何修復「找不到 mysql_config」錯誤?

DDD
發布: 2024-11-29 19:56:16
原創
655 人瀏覽過

How to Fix the

Mac OS X:解決Django MySQLdb 的“mysql_config not found”錯誤

問題描述:

嘗試安裝Django 框架以與Google App Engine一起使用時,因下列原因發生錯誤缺少MySQLdb 模組:

ImproperlyConfigured: Error loading MySQLdb module: No module named MySQLdb
登入後複製

依照網路建議安裝MySQL-Python,會產生以下錯誤:

EnvironmentError: mysql_config not found
登入後複製

解決方案:

依照下列步驟解決問題問題:

  1. 檢查MySQL 設定是否遺失:

    • 執行指令上指令which mysql_config 來檢查my_config可執行檔的位置。如果沒有找到,請使用locate mysql_config嘗試找到它。
  2. 使用MySQL Connector Python:

    • 安裝mysql -connector-python 使用:ppippixp 。
    • 跟隨文件位於 https://dev.mysql.com/doc/connector-python/en/connector-python-introduction.html。
  3. 更新$PATH環境變數:

    • 手動找到mysql/bin、mysql_config和MySQL-Python,並將SQL-Pyt它們添加到$PATH 環境變數中。
  4. 使用MacPorts 安裝MySQL:

    • 安裝使用MacPorts 的MySQL (https://www.mac.mac /install.php)。
    • 重新命名mysql_config 為 mysql_config5。
    • 設定$PATH 變數:export PATH=$PATH:/opt/local/lib/mysql5/bin.
  5. 安裝附加軟體包(可選):

    • 嘗試安裝python-dev 和 libmysqlclient-dev (這些軟體包可能在 Mac OS 上不可用)。

額外注意:

  • 如有必要,請以 root 身分執行指令。
  • 請參閱以下資源以了解更多資訊協助:

    • https://stackoverflow.com/questions/27598786/pip-install-mysql-python-fails -with-environmenterror-mysql-config-not-found
    • https://stackoverflow.com/questions/21573668/pip-install-mysqlclient-gives-err or-mysql-config-not-found
    • https://community.oracle.com/tech/developers/ discussion/4178520/error-mysql-confi g-not-found
    • https://mysqlclient.readthedocs.io/en/latest/faq.html#where-can-i-find-mysql-config

以上是在 macOS 上安裝 MySQLdb for Django 時如何修復「找不到 mysql_config」錯誤?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板